Those students will be allowed to study remotely.The province has outlined a set of requirements schools must follow in developing their plans for the fall.Schools on the Island are preparing to welcome all students back to class, while drafting backup plans for remote studies if required.Education Minister Zach Churchill says the province’s objective is for schools to return to 100 per cent capacity in the fall, but its plan includes measures to address the possible onset of a second wave of COVID-19.The province’s back-to-school plan aims to maximize in-class attendance with the option of a return to remote learning if the COVID-19 risk increases.The province said it will add virtual teaching positions to support students who are immunocompromised, or who have a family member at risk of severe complications from COVID-19. It said it was also adding 25 guidance councillors, hiring up to 25 more custodians and hiring 70 substitute teachers on term contracts for specific schools.The territorial government says it’s making plans for the next school year that include flexibility around the number of students in classes if there’s a second wave of COVID-19 or increased risk of transmission. Measures will be tightened if an outbreak occurs and class sizes could be reduced to 20.Saskatchewan first unveiled a set of back-to-school guidelines in June, but released more details and made some changes in August.The Manitoba government says students are going back to the classroom on Sept. 8 with new guidelines.Ontario students will be back in class September, but their schedules and class sizes may vary depending on where they live.All elementary and high school students in Quebec will be required to attend class in September unless they have a doctor’s note indicating they’re at high risk of COVID-19 complications or they live with someone at risk.
